The is a popular 80mm thermal receipt printer widely used in retail and hospitality for high-speed POS (Point of Sale) tasks. Ensuring you have the correct driver is essential for features like auto-cutting, logo printing, and clear font rendering. Driver Overview and Official Source

Most businesses link a cash drawer to the bottom of the GP-U80160I via an RJ11 cable. To make it open automatically: Go to →right arrow Right-click your printer →right arrow Printer properties . Click on the Device Settings tab. Locate the Peripheral Unit Type or Cash Select option.
